I am currently in like 10 networks... Was wondering how hectic it is when it comes to paying tax at the end of the year.
As long as you are keeping good records for every source of income and every business expense you have... it should not be hectic at all. Instead of waiting until tax is due... you can plan for it by ensuring you have the receipts at hand as and when you get them (and even a very basic monthly sheet listing income and expenses will help you quickly find the figures needed for your tax form). Filling a tax form is only a hassle or problematic if you don't keep your records organized
What kind of receipts? I am currently only 17 so yea this is my first time around into this tax world. Help please
Some type of receipts are: 1. webhosting costs (print out the invoice) 2. domain price (print out invoice etc) 3. advertising costs (print out invoice) 4. outsourced work (print out invoice) Basically anything you pay out and it is used for your busines, you should look at having a receipt for it - or getting a receipt. Even paypal can be used to help you keep track... but it is good to have individual receipts instead of just a list (a list is useful for summary purposes - maybe a monthly printout of paypal income and a montly printout of paypal invoices paid etc)

You would need to speak to your local tax office and find out what you can deduct... it all depends on what is business use and personal use etc. If you paid bills like electricity, you could have some allocated as business use (like maybe 25% of it or something). Similarly, as the computer is both business and personal... depends when it was bought and reason for puchase. The same goes for the associated peripheral equipment.
